First rolling stock for LOMT dispatched from Karachi
LAHORE, SEPT 20 (DNA) – The first shipment of rolling stock for Lahore Orange Line Metro Train (LOMT), which had arrived Pakistan from China last week, has been dispatched to Lahore from Karachi and is expected to reach here during the next week.
Advisor to the Punjab chief minister and Chairman of the steering committee for LOMT Project Khawaja Ahmad Haassan has announced to arrange a special ceremony on the 7th of October at Dera Gujjran depot for celebrating the arrival of the first set of train.
Presiding the weekly progress review meeting ib Wednesday, he informed that the Chinese contractor CR-NORINCO has released the schedule for the arrival of locomotives for the train in Lahore. As many as 23 train sets will arrive Lahore by the end of this year and coaches for all the 27 trains will be available in Lahore by the mid of March 2018.
